In today's episode of India Global An Indian entrepreneur's nightmare unfolded at Alaska's Anchorage Airport. Shruti Chaturvedi, founder of India Action Project, detained for eight hours—stripped of warm clothes, subjected to a male officer's physical check, and questioned by the FBI, all over a 'suspicious' power bank. Denied basic rights; no restroom, no phone call, forced to miss her flight. Chaturvedi shared her ordeal on social media, calling it the 'worst experience' of her life.
